First off I'd like to start by saying D12 debuted pretty well, selling 371,000, a little under what was expected, but he outsold Mandy More (Debuted at 35...LOL..Biatch!), Sisqo (Number 7), Blink 182 (Numer 3) and Staind (Number 2)...And of course D12 (Number 1)...I bet it will sell even more the second week because "Purple Hills" is just catching on with the mainstream...Plus they got "Nutthin But Music" as the next single which will sell them a lot more...
